
Smoked Salmon and Dill Appetizer
⏳ Time
20 minutes
🥕 Ingredients
11
🍽️ Servings
4
Description
This appetizer will effortlessly adorn your holiday table and delight you with its flavor!
Ingredients
- Potato - 8.8 oz
- Smoked Salmon Flavored Croutons - 7.1 oz
- Ricotta cheese - 2 tablespoons
- Chopped Green Onions - 2 tablespoons
- Lemon - 1 piece
- Creamy Horseradish - 1 teaspoon
- Capers - 1 tablespoon
- Salt - to taste
- Ground Black Pepper - to taste
- Cake crumbs - 4 tablespoons
- Olive Oil - to taste
Step by Step guide
Step 1
Preheat the oven to 392°F.
Step 2
Peel the potatoes, cut them into small pieces, and boil in boiling water until soft, about 20 minutes. Drain and let cool slightly. Mash into a puree, mixing with ricotta.
Step 3
Transfer the potato mixture to a bowl and add finely chopped fish, dill, grated lemon zest, horseradish, and finely chopped capers (if desired). Season with salt and pepper.
Step 4
Mix well and shape the mixture into balls the size of walnuts. Slightly flatten each one and roll in breadcrumbs.
Step 5
Place on a baking sheet greased with olive oil.
Step 6
Drizzle with olive oil on top and bake in the oven for 10-12 minutes, turning 1-2 times, until cooked and golden brown.
